Andrew Lewman
|
abb5febd8a
oops, forgot the changelog reference for r16867.
|
16 years ago |
Andrew Lewman
|
abce15b993
Patch from Camilo Viecco to make the rpm spec arch independent, as far
|
16 years ago |
Karsten Loesing
|
f0a5ef804f
Directory mirrors store and serve v2 hidden service descriptors by default.
|
16 years ago |
Roger Dingledine
|
535e2074bc
give lasse's last name a different charset
|
16 years ago |
Roger Dingledine
|
2f18370821
and here too
|
16 years ago |
Nick Mathewson
|
b322348e8a
Fix more actual test leaks
|
16 years ago |
Nick Mathewson
|
45205126fe
Fix some apparent leaks in voting. If authorities suddenly start segfaulting, this could be a patch to look harder at.
|
16 years ago |
Nick Mathewson
|
aa69d586ea
Make buffer unit tests handle resource leaks properly.
|
16 years ago |
Nick Mathewson
|
38f56608d9
Make more unit tests handle resource leaks properly.
|
16 years ago |
Nick Mathewson
|
1203850350
Coverity says it is okay to acknowledge them. Do so. Their tool is awesome.
|
16 years ago |
Karsten Loesing
|
52fbfc5d45
Correct indentation.
|
16 years ago |
Roger Dingledine
|
659f1651e0
tweak karsten's patch
|
16 years ago |
Roger Dingledine
|
2c14705a4d
patch from karsten to fix more of bug 767
|
16 years ago |
Nick Mathewson
|
f95d7c189b
Refactor unit test macros and tor_free_all() logic a bit so as to make it easier to free memory on failing tests, in order to suppress scanner warnings and to make dmalloc() usable with tests.
|
16 years ago |
Nick Mathewson
|
6c432a5565
Replace the dummy-use var in SMARTLIST_FOREACH_END() with one that is less likely to confuse analysis tools into thinking we do use after free. Arguably, (void)x should count as use in suppressing unused variable warnings, but not in generating hey-you-used-a-variable warnings. Arguably, though, it shouldn't.
|
16 years ago |
Roger Dingledine
|
fa64d8041f
minor cleanups on karsten's patch
|
16 years ago |
Roger Dingledine
|
ef7af1d61e
karsten's patch for bug 767.
|
16 years ago |
Roger Dingledine
|
d37fae2f4e
Catch and report a few more bootstrapping failure cases when Tor
|
16 years ago |
Nick Mathewson
|
aacda9cd8e
We should not alter an addr_policy_t that has been canonicalized.
|
16 years ago |
Roger Dingledine
|
346ca2d48e
forward-port the 0.2.0.31 changelog
|
16 years ago |
Nick Mathewson
|
67327a863a
Fix a variable handling mistake when testing for libevent functions in configure.in. Found by Riastradh.
|
16 years ago |
Nick Mathewson
|
baeb260ad1
Refactor use of connection_new so that we get more verifiable typesafety.
|
16 years ago |
Nick Mathewson
|
cd5d0f3890
Add changelog for scanner-based stuff.
|
16 years ago |
Nick Mathewson
|
339f094056
Refactor some code and add some asserts based on scanner results.
|
16 years ago |
Nick Mathewson
|
a345506672
Add an assert to make tools happier.
|
16 years ago |
Nick Mathewson
|
d5b2dab31d
Fix a malloc that should have been a tor_malloc
|
16 years ago |
Nick Mathewson
|
0b8117a5c0
Fix numerous memory leaks: some were almost impossible to trigger, and some almost inevitable.
|
16 years ago |
Nick Mathewson
|
4d94e061c7
Clean up some redundant stuff in crypto_dh_new().
|
16 years ago |
Nick Mathewson
|
a56a072f29
It is probably some kind of misdeed to say for (i=0;i<2;++i) { A=i?x:y; foo(bar(A)); } rather than foo(bar(x)); foo(bar(y)); . Also, it can confuse tools.
|
16 years ago |
Nick Mathewson
|
a6ea2b056a
Fix a memory leak in tor-gencert.c
|
16 years ago |